Word > File > … SpletChoose a page size. Select the Page Design tab. In the Page Setup group, select Size and click the icon that represents the page size that you want. For example, click Letter (Portrait) 8.5 x 11". If you don’t see the size you want, either click More Preset Page Sizes or click Create New Page Size to create a custom page size.
